ORGANISER'S COMMENTS

 

Surprisingly, the the early morning rain that turned the car park into a quagmire had not been forecast.  But this did not seem to deter the eagerness of competitors keen to get back into the forest after the long break due to Foot & Mouth.  Many thanks indeed to all those who helped pull/push cars out of the mud before and after the event.

 

We had two Start locations this time and it was unfortunate that they had to be so far from the car park.  Great care was taken to find the shortest and safest routes to the Starts and no incidents were reported from crossing the busy "A" road.  The great joy after reaching the Starts was to behold Epping Forest in all its autumnal glory.  I hope that this added to your enjoyment of the event.

 

On the administrative side, we had a large EOD for the Badge courses and were lucky to accommodate most competitors.  So please, please pre-book whenever you can as it makes our preparation so much easier.  Also, do not expect Reception/Registration to be open half an hour before the published time.  I know that you may want the best choice of EOD Badge courses, but staff still need the chance to set up and be ready for you.

 

Finally, a big thank you goes to all those stalwart CHIG's who gave so freely of their time to help before and on the day.  All our plans are futile if you are not there to make it work.

PLANNER'S COMMENTS (SOUTH START, COURSES 1-11)

 

Epping NW is not a particularly large area and the decision was taken not to use much of the western escarpment slope because of fallen trees & undergrowth, thus the reason for the start & finish position. Also the Epping Forest conservators imposed some restrictions in the very northern section because of deer. For all these reasons it was a struggle to get the distance for M21L without introducing complicated loop backs over previous terrain. In the end all the courses were a little shorter than my original targets.

 

I tried to avoid the nastier areas and keep the running flowing through the nicer parts in the south and also, for those who crossed the road, in the north section. This I think contributed to the mins per km; some winning times were certainly faster than previous events on this area. Most courses were within recommended times, although some were at the bottom of the range. Overall I tried to get some technical complexity out of the legs and avoid path runs, and judging by the favourable comments this was achieved.

PLANNER'S COMMENTS (NORTH START, COURSES 12-17)

 

We agreed early that a separate Start/Finish was needed for the junior courses.  This was due to the busy A121 to cross (bet the adults noticed this!) and the ill defined path system on the southern part of the map.  Anyway, the northern half of the map is regarded as one on the best bits of Epping Forest - gently undulating and fast run.  It also meant that we could expand this part of the map to 1:10,000 for the badge entrants.  Thanks to John Pearce and his OCAD skills.

 

The shortest course, 17, was easy to plot following the path system.  Courses 15 and 16 were more difficult so a taped route between controls 140, 114 & 113 was devised.  I hope this did not result in these courses being less enjoyable.

 

We also had to incorporate a short courses 12 for the old 'uns.  Although the times were long, there were no retirals.

 

The colour coded courses utilised the 1:15,000 maps and were not pre-marked or bagged.

 

We were able to use the most northern part of the map for the first time in six years.  It was more runable than previous.  We were also able to keep the herd of deer away from the competitors by moving them to the eastern corner.

 

I also hope those long courses competitors enjoyed this part of the map, although it was a bit disconcerting to see a number running through the start/finish area.  Fortunately, there were not many people in these areas - a definite advantage of electronic punching.  I was informed that this was not the optimum route - I'll leave you to decide.

 

No panics on the day.  The electronic punches worked and all controls remained in position and all kit was recovered before the rain set in at the end of the day.

  CONTROLLER'S COMMENTS

 

Judging by the comments of competitors immediately after finishing (and since the event), you enjoyed the testing courses set by the planners.   A number of the senior competitors particularly remarked on the pleasant lack of optimal path-running routes on their courses.   The senior competitors also enjoyed the rare opportunity of running in the pleasant northern section terrain.   It is clear from listening to your route descriptions and scanning the split times that Epping continues to catch out even the most experienced competitors – small lapses of concentration can cause significant time lost in relocating.   It is a pity that there was not a larger turnout to appreciate the planners' considerable efforts.   Ray Weekes deserves special praise for coping calmly with replanning the M21L course when (with 10 days to go and the courses at the printers) the landowners ruled out the use of a key control site.

 

The remote parking, starts, finishes and road-crossings were dictated by the logistics of running a Badge event on this area and complying with the requests of the landowners who wished to avoid large concentrations of competitors in the northern section of the area.   This put the limited resources of CHIG under severe pressure.   However, the cracks apparent to us on the day were not for the most part visible to the competitors and the team coped.   The SI punching worked very well (giving the planners greater freedom without needing to worry about manned controls or map exchanges), but a hardware failure caused temporary difficulties with split times and, regrettably, prevented the production and display of on-the-day results.
